> Felix qui potuit rerum cognoscere causas. > (Lucky is one who has been able to understand causality.) > - Virgil, Georgics ii.490
The right translation is: "Happy is one who could understand the causes of things", if I am not wrong. (I have studied only a little Latin, but it is sometimes very close to Spanish.)
